      WellnessLiving currently offers four pricing plans. While these tiers are now more transparent, there’s still plenty hidden behind upsells—particularly around white-labeled apps, website creation, and streaming services.
Here’s a breakdown of the current WellnessLiving pricing tiers:
| Plan Name | Standard Price | Promo Price (First 2 Months) | Key Limitations & Notes | 
|---|---|---|---|
| Starter | $69/mo | N/A | Only 1 staff seat, limited scheduling, no add-ons | 
| Business | $199/mo | $39/mo (for 2 months) | Unlimited staff, core reports, POS, CRM | 
| BusinessPro | $349/mo | $69/mo (for 2 months) | Advanced automation, branded experience, loyalty tools | 
| Enterprise | Custom | N/A | Multi-location, account manager, full suite |

What is WellnessLiving?
WellnessLiving is a cloud-based gym and wellness business management software offering scheduling, point of sale, client management, and marketing tools for fitness studios, gyms, and health professionals.
WellnessLiving pricing starts at $69/month for the Starter plan but rises to $199/month or $349/month for more advanced features. Their top-tier Enterprise plan is custom-priced. Limited-time promotional prices (such as $39 or $69/month) are sometimes offered for the first two months.
The Starter plan is very limited. It only includes one staff profile, basic scheduling, email notifications, and access to their core database and point-of-sale tools. No advanced analytics, automations, or branding are included.
